The Fundamentals of Metal Finishing - Normally, metal finishing is needed for aesthetic reasons or for clean-room uses. It's one of the most recognized practices simply because of its utility in intensifying the overall attractiveness of the items, such as, cookware, auto parts or motorbike parts. Moreover, a lot of clean-rooms would need a sleek finish as a way to lower the permeability of the metal surfaces which might result in dirt to gather and contaminate. A superb example of this implementation might be in vacuum chambers.

There are actually countless approaches to finish metal, and we'll have a look at some of the procedures involved. Metal can be finished utilising chemicals, electromechanically, using specialized buffing machines, or manually. A special polishing compound or paste is regularly employed, that may consist of ch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its substandard th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its rather high viscidity is just about the time intensive. More over, items constructed from non-ferrous metals are much more receptive to finishing, as they need the lower amount of treatments.

A reduced pad speed can be used when a quality mirror finish is called for. Finishing buffs coated with compound are greatly impacted by the load on the surface of the polishing pad. The force of the pressure on the surface can be heightened within certain restrictions, though surpassing the most effective measure of force not just minimizes the quality level of treatment, but additionally can degrade performance, can lead to wear to the part, and moreover an evident overheating of the work-pieces, due to friction. When working thin material, it's elevated heat (and the corresponding pliability of the metal) that cause items to flex, buckle or warp. In general, it will require an educated polisher to take into account every one of these points to both avert harm to the workpiece and to perform the work successfully. For you to appreciably enhance the quality of the resulting finish, the buffing operation is required to be implemented with reduced aggression and not a large amount of force in an effort to in time deliver a surface area that is free of scratches or fine lines resulting from the buffing procedure, subsequently arriving at a sleek mirror finish.
